[JBoss Messaging] - MessagingPostOfficeService MBean View on jmx-console is not
by gaohoward
Hi,
JBoss AS 4.2.3
JBM 1.4.2.GA-SP1
Starting JBoss AS, open jmx-console and open the mbean view for post office (service=postoffice), look at the Value fields of ControlChannelConfig and DataChannelConfig, you will see incomplete values for them, like:
<UDP discard_incompatible_packets=
The result is that, if you click 'Apply Changes' button, the console will end in exception:
exception
org.jboss.util.NestedRuntimeException: XML document structures must start and end within the same entity.; - nested throwable: (org.xml.sax.SAXParseException: XML document structures must start and end within the same entity.)
